- Gallery Wall:
Create a visually striking display by arranging a collection of artworks in a gallery wall. Mix and match different sizes, frames, and art styles to add visual interest. Experiment with symmetrical or asymmetrical layouts for a personalized touch. - Statement Piece:
Let a single bold and eye-catching artwork take center stage as a statement piece. Choose a large-scale painting, photograph, or unique art installation that reflects your personality and complements the room’s overall decor. - Unexpected Placements:
Break away from traditional conventions and hang art in unexpected places. Consider placing artwork above a fireplace, on the ceiling, or even on a bookshelf. These unconventional placements create visual surprises and add a touch of whimsy. - Create a Theme:
Curate a collection of artworks that revolve around a specific theme or concept. For example, you can create a botanical-themed gallery with nature-inspired paintings, prints, and botanical illustrations. This thematic approach adds cohesiveness and tells a story through art. - Mix Art with Functional Pieces:
Combine wall art with functional items to create a unique and practical display. Hang art pieces above a desk, bar cart, or console table to create a stylish and functional vignette. This blend of art and function adds depth and personality to the space. - Layered Wall Art:
Experiment with layering different art pieces to add depth and dimension. Place smaller artworks in front of larger ones or overlap frames for an artistic and dynamic effect. This technique creates an intriguing visual composition that captures attention. - Textural Wall Art:
Explore three-dimensional and textural art pieces to add depth to your walls. Consider sculptures, woven wall hangings, or mixed media artworks. These tactile elements create a sensory experience and add visual interest to your decor. - Statement Wall Murals:
Opt for a striking wall mural to create a captivating focal point in a room. Choose a mural that complements your style and the room’s purpose. From abstract designs to scenic landscapes, wall murals can transform a space into a work of art. - Frameless Artwork:
Embrace the modern and minimalist aesthetic by displaying frameless artwork. Showcase canvas prints, tapestries, or posters directly on the wall for a sleek and contemporary look. This approach allows the artwork itself to take center stage. - Artistic Arrangements:
Arrange smaller art pieces in creative patterns or grids to create a cohesive and visually appealing arrangement. Experiment with geometric shapes, such as squares, diamonds, or hexagons, to showcase your art collection in a unique and artistic way.
